Permanent vs Rolloff dumpsters
Whether or not you require a long-term or roll-off dumpster is dependent upon the type of job and service you will need. Permanent dumpster service is for enduring needs that continue more than just a couple of days. This includes matters like day to day waste and recycling needs. Temporary service is just what the name suggests; a one time demand for project-special waste removal.
Temporary roll off dumpsters are delivered on a truck and are rolled off where they will be utilized. All these are generally bigger containers that could handle all the waste that comes with that particular job. Permanent dumpsters are generally smaller containers since they're emptied on a regular basis and so do not need to hold as much at one time.
Should you request a long-lasting dumpster, some companies need at least a one-year service agreement for that dumpster. Rolloff dumpsters only need a rental fee for the time that you just keep the dumpster on the job.
When will my dumpster get picked up?
You'll generally schedule the amount of time you plan to keep the dumpster when you first telephone to set up your dumpster service. This normally includes the dropoff and pick-up dates. Most businesses do request that you be present when the dumpster is delivered. This really is necessary to make sure the dumpster is put in the very best location for your job. You really do not have to be present when the dumpster is picked up to haul it away.
In case you get into your job and recognize you need pick-up sooner or later than you initially requested, that is no issue. Just telephone the company's office and explain what you need, and they'll do everything they can to accommodate your request. There might be times they cannot fulfill your adjusted program precisely due to previous obligations, but they'll do the best they are able to in order to pick your dumpster up at the appropriate time.

What's the Difference Between a Roll Off and Front Load Dumpster?
Roll off and front load dumpsters have attributes that make them useful for various kinds of jobs.
A roll off dumpster is delivered to your project location and left there until you want a truck to haul it and your debris away. They normally have open tops and also a door on the front. This makes it easy for workers to load a wide variety of debris into the dumpster.
A front load dumpster has mechanical arms that that lift containers off the ground. The arms tip to pour the debris into the truck's dumpster. It is a useful option for businesses that accumulate considerable amounts of garbage.
While roll off dumpsters are normally left on location, front load dumpsters will come pick up debris on a set schedule. This makes it possible for sanitation professionals to remove garbage and junk for multiple dwellings and businesses in the region at affordable prices.
What is the biggest size dumpster accessible?
The biggest roll-off dumpster that businesses normally rent is a 40 yard container. This gigantic dumpster will hold up to 40 cubic yards of debris, which is equivalent to between 12 and 20 pickup truck loads of debris.
The weight limitation on 40 yard containers typically ranges from 4 to 8 tons (8,000 to 16,000 pounds). Be very conscious of the limitation and do your best not to exceed it. If you do go over the limit, you can incur overage costs, which add up quickly.
Examples of jobs that a 40 yard container will probably be the perfect size for include: A foreclosure or estate cleanout A 750 square foot deck removal 4,000 square feet of roofing shingles in multiple layers Whole-home interior renovation Getting rid of trash when you are moving in or out House demolition New house construction Commercial and residential cleanouts

What Size Dumpster Should I Get for a Residential Clean Out in Mechanicsville?
Residential clean outs usually don't demand large dumpsters. The size that you require, however, will depend on the size of the job.
If your plan is to clean out the entire home, then you probably need a 20-yard roll off dumpster. You could also use this size for a sizable cellar or loft clean out.
If you only need to clean out a room or two, then you certainly may want to decide on a 10-yard dumpster.
When choosing a dumpster, though, it's often a good idea to request a size larger than what you believe you'll need. Unless you're a professional, it's tough to estimate the precise size required for your job. By getting a somewhat larger size, you spend a bit more cash, however you also avoid the possibility you will run out of room. Renting a larger dumpster is almost always cheaper than renting two small ones.
What Size Dumpster Do I Need for a Roofing Job?
Choosing a dumpster size requires some educated guesswork. It is often problematic for people to estimate the sizes that they need for roofing projects because, practically, they don't know how much stuff their roofs include.
There are, however, some basic guidelines you'll be able to follow to make a good alternative. In case you are removing a commercial roof, then you will most likely require a dumpster that gives you at least 40 square yards.
In case you are working on residential roofing job, then you can ordinarily rely on a smaller size. You can typically expect a 1,500 square foot roof to fill a 10-yard dumpster. Single shingle roof debris from a 2,500-3,000 square foot roof will probably desire a 20-yard dumpster.
A lot of people order one size bigger than they believe their endeavors will take because they would like to avoid the additional expense and hassle of replacing complete dumpsters which weren't large enough.

What is the smallest size dumpster accessible?
The smallest size roll off dumpster typically accessible is 10 yards. This container will carry about 10 cubic yards of waste and debris, which is roughly equivalent to 3 to 5 pickup truck loads of waste. This dumpster is a great choice for small-scale jobs, like small home cleanouts.
Other examples of jobs that a 10 yard container would work nicely for contain: A garage, shed or loft cleanout A 250 square foot deck removal 2,000 to 2,500 square feet of single layer roofing shingles A modest kitchen or bathroom remodeling project Concrete or dirt removal Getting rid of junk Be aware that weight restrictions for the containers are enforced, thus exceeding the weight limit will incur additional costs. The normal weight limitation for a 10 yard bin is 1 to 3 tons (2,000 to 6,000 pounds).
A 10 yard bin will allow you to take good care of small jobs around the home. When you have a bigger project coming up, take a look at some bigger containers also.
30 yard dumpster measurements in Mechanicsville
If you rent a 30 yard dumpster, you will be receiving a container that can hold 30 cubic yards of waste or debris. Your 30 yard container will measure about 22 feet long by 8 feet wide by 6 feet high. These numbers could vary slightly determined by the dumpster rental company in Mechanicsville you select. A 30 yard dumpster will hold between 9 and 15 pickup truck loads of waste, so itis an excellent choice for whole-home residential cleanouts in addition to commercial cleaning projects.
Examples of projects that would generate enough waste for a 30 yard container contain:
- A leading home add-on
- Building of a brand new home
- A garage demolition
- Whole-home window or siding replacement (for a small- to medium-size home)
The weight allowance for a 30 yard dumpster will range from 2 to 8 tons (4,000 to 16,000 pounds). Make sure you don't exceed this weight limitation or you could face overage charges.
